Bertha Scoles was retired from Triplett Corp.
Bertha E. Scoles, 97, died March 24, 2013, at her residence. She was born in Belvidere, Ill., on Feb. 24, 1916, to the late Orville and Marry (Masse) Coulter. She married Cleo Garau and he preceded her in death. On Nov. 24, 1965 she married Gerald Scoles and he died Dec. 31, 1995.
Mrs. Scoles retired from Triplett Corp., Bluffton and was a farmer’s wife. She was a member of First Missionary Church, Bluffton.
Survivors include a nephew and caregiver Randy Scoles of Bluffton; several other nieces and nephews; and a sister Priscilla Birdwell of Zanesville, Ohio.
A son Stephen Garau; two brothers Orville and George Coulter; and two sisters Edna Bowers and Martha Hamm preceded her in death.
Services will be held 10 a.m. Thursday at Chiles-Laman Funeral & Cremation Services, Bluffton. Rev. Gary Marks officiating. Burial will be in Maple Grove Cemetery, Bluffton.
Friends and family may call Wednesday from 2-4 and 6-8 p.m. at the funeral home.
Memorial contributions may be made to First Missionary Church.
